Output 29f126657de4af893b423a992f2075d30d474932102e5de306d3d7906db6dabc:0

value
38744000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ea9b3c097280ac65a89bc09a09c9a398cf183c7 OP_EQUAL
address
3Bn9YkuCG5w2cme7y4Nsm8m7uWNqUMLe5q
transaction
29f126657de4af893b423a992f2075d30d474932102e5de306d3d7906db6dabc
spent
true